About 8 Quernmore Road
8 Quernmore Road is a four-bedroom mid-terrace house in Haringey, London, London (N4 4QU). It has a recorded floor area of 193 m² (around 2077 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(February 2025) shows an E (score 44),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The rating has held steady at E across 2 certificates since November 2014.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Good to Very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Average to Very Poor and window efficiency d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to D (score 67). Period features are noted in the property record.
Last sale on file: £1,400,000 in November 2020.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. Across 1997–2020,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.7%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£1,786,000 is 27.6% above the 2020 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£674/sq ft) was about 114.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2007.
